Definitions

  • the invention relates to a solenoid valve according to the preamble of independent claim 1.
  • a conventional solenoid valve in particular for a hydraulic unit, which is used for example in an anti-lock braking system (ABS) or a traction control system (ASR system) or an electronic stability program system (ESP system) is shown in Figure 2.
  • the conventional solenoid valve 1 comprises a magnet assembly 6 with a cover disk 7 and a housing jacket 8, a valve cartridge which comprises a capsule 20, a valve insert 10, a plunger 5, a return spring 30 and an armature 40.
  • the capsule 20 and the valve insert 10 of the valve cartridge are joined together by pressing and by a sealing weld 21, the valve cartridge is hydraulically sealed from the atmosphere.
  • the lower connection of the magnet group 6 is done by directly pressing the cover 7 on the magnetically conductive valve core 10 of the valve cartridge.
  • the valve core 10 receives the pressure forces occurring in the hydraulic system and forwards them via a caulking flange 11 onto a fluid block 9.
  • the caulking flange 11 has a first caulking region 3 with a first diameter and a second caulking region 2 with a second smaller diameter and the height 4 for caulking 12 with the flipper block.
  • the fluid block 9, on which the solenoid valve 1 is mounted by caulking, is usually made of aluminum. By caulking 12, the position of the valve cartridge is fixed in the fluid block 9 and the pressure chamber is sealed against the atmosphere. As can be seen further from FIG.
  • the solenoid valve according to the invention with the features of independent claim 1 has the advantage that a second caulking for caulking of the solenoid valve is formed with a fluid block having a second diameter which is smaller than a first diameter of a first caulking, from the housing shell of a magnetic assembly, which is joined to a valve core.
  • the part of the solenoid valve projecting from the fluid block also shortens, so that advantageously the housing volume of the overall assembly is reduced, into which the fluid block is integrated with the solenoid valve.
  • valve insert and a plunger of the solenoid valve can be shortened by the amount of lowering of the magnet assembly, whereby the height of the solenoid valve further reduced and advantageously further reductions in weight and housing volume of the entire aggregate can be achieved.
  • the magnet assembly is pressed via a cover at least partially in the caulking directly on the valve core.
  • a transition region can be arranged between the first caulking region and the second caulking region, which reduces the first diameter of the first caulking region in steps and / or continuously to the second diameter of the second caulking region.
  • Figure 1 is a schematic sectional view of a solenoid valve according to the invention.
  • Figure 2 is a schematic sectional view of a conventional solenoid valve.
  • a magnetic valve 100 comprises a magnet assembly 6, which comprises a cover disk 7 and a housing jacket 8, and a valve cartridge, which comprises a capsule 20, a valve insert 110, a plunger 105, a return spring 30 and an armature 40 includes.
  • the capsule 20 and the valve core 110 of the valve cartridge of the solenoid valve 100 according to the invention are joined together during manufacture by pressing and sealed by a sealing weld 21 against the atmosphere.
  • the valve insert 110 of the solenoid valve 100 according to the invention has for caulking 12 with a fluid block 9, for example made of aluminum, a caulking flange 111 with a first caulking region 3, which is designed with a first diameter.
  • the first diameter of the first caulking region 3 for the caulking 12 with the fluid block 9 is made larger.
  • the caulking flange 111 of the solenoid valve 100 according to the invention does not have a second caulking region 2 with a second diameter and a height 4.
  • the function of the second Verstemm Schemes 2 with the second diameter is taken over in the solenoid valve 100 of the invention from a lower portion 102 of the housing shell 8 of the magnet assembly 6, wherein the first diameter of the caulking flange 111 is increased so that the first diameter is greater than that of the second diameter Outer diameter of the housing shell 8 of the magnet assembly 6 is executed.
  • the magnet assembly 6 is shifted by the height 4 down into the fluid block 9.
  • the height of the valve cartridge of the solenoid valve 100 according to the invention by the height 4 relative to the valve cartridge of the conventional solenoid valve 1 can be shortened.
  • the connection of the magnet assembly 6 via the cover 7 is at least partially in the caulking 12, so the magnet assembly 6 is pressed via the cover 7, for example directly to the valve core 110.
  • the second caulking region 2 of the caulking flange 11 of the valve insert 5 of the conventional solenoid valve 1 is not completely eliminated, but is designed as a transitional region, which gradually and / or gradually increases the first diameter of the caulked region 3 of the caulking flange 111 of the solenoid valve 100 according to the invention. or continuously reduced to the second diameter of the second Verstemm Kunststoffs, ie As a result, the strength of the caulking 12 can be adjusted to the force flow caused by the pressure difference between the internal pressure and the atmospheric pressure.
  • the solenoid valve according to the invention can preferably be used in hydraulic units which are part of an anti-lock braking system (ABS) or a traction control system (ASR system) or an electronic stability program system (ESP system).

Abstract

L'invention concerne une électrovanne dotée d'une garniture (110) à laquelle est abouté un ensemble magnétique (6) comportant une enveloppe de boîtier (8). La garniture (110), pour le matage (12) avec un bloc fluidique (9), comprend une bride de matage (111) pourvue d'une première zone de matage (3) présentant un premier diamètre. Selon l'invention, une deuxième zone de matage (102) présentant un deuxième diamètre inférieur au premier est formée par l'enveloppe de boîtier (8) de l'ensemble magnétique (6).
